A weekend for the ages will be here on July 19 and July 20, 2013. Tons of money and prizes will be up for grabs at Cerro Gordo Speedway in Cerro Gordo, Illinois on Friday July 19th, and Saturday July 20th at Ealeyville Speedway in Mechanicsburg, Illinois.
Friday night at Cerro Gordo Speedway the Unilli Money Series will take the third leg of the series to the track. The winner will walk away with $1000.00 just like Ty England and Chad Ziegler have done already. Second through fifth will walk away with $500.00 each. This race is for the Adult Clone 380. It has a Unilli tire rule, but a no kart minimum. Also racing with the Unilli Money Series will be a full racing program which includes Opens, Jr1, Jr3, Stock, Wing Sprints, Cadets and several different weight classes on Adult Clones. Cerro Gordo Speedway offers a 70% payback on all its classes excluding Cadets. There will be all sorts of prizes up for grabs as well, such as: Karting Oil, Gift Certificates to multiple businesses and much more. Cerro Gordo Speedway is located on the Piatt County Fairgrounds in Cerro Gordo, Illinois. Gates open at 4pm, Hot Laps at 6:30pm and Racing around 7pm.
Then the weekend shifts gears and heads up the road just a few miles to Ealeyville Speedway in Mechanicsburg, Illinois. They will host the first ever Cash Classic. Ealeyville Speedway, who rarely runs for any money prizes, will take a back seat and allow their track to become the centerpiece of the weekend. The head-liner of the day will be the Adult Pro Clone 380. They will be racing for a $1200 purse. It will pay $500 to the winner and pay back as far as tenth place. There will also be a $100.00 Missile Cuts Hard Charger Award to the kart who passes the most karts in the feature.There will be a no kart minimum and an unheard of open tire rule for this type of purse. The Clones will not only be the ones looking for a nice payday. The Opens, Wing Sprint Karts, 6.5 Opens, and Adult Clone 380 will be fighting for a $400.00 Purse in each division. There will be an open tire rule and only a 10 kart minimum for these divisions. Also on the racing program for the day: racing for trophies will be Jr1, Jr3, Cadets, and Jr Wing. Then the highlight of the day that EVERY Class is eligible for - a $500.00 contingency! One kart from every class will have an opportunity to win the contingency. For every $25 spent at SyntheticLubeStore.com or at the official AMSOIL Dealer of the Ealeyville Speedway, Gabe Gerberding will give you an entry. The winner or first finisher with at least one entry will be entered into the contingency drawing. All of winners entries will be submitted, therefore increasing their chances. After the last feature is ran, one entry will be drawn. If entry drawn was a feature winner in their respected class they will receive the $500.00. If the entrant drawn was not the winner in there division but indeed was the top finisher with entries then they will receive a $250 contingency. RECEIPT MUST BE PROVIDED BEFORE ENTRIES ARE SUBMITTED. There will be prizes such as tire prep, shirts, hats, gift certificates and more up for grabs throughout the day. Proud Sponsors of the Cash Classic are Missile Cuts, Highside Graphix, ARC Racing, AMSOIL, SyntheticLubeStore.com, and A.J.'s Services. Ealeyville Speedway gates open at 10am, Hot Laps start at 2pm and racing at 3.
